In 2023 SDG&E requested a revenue increase of 3.6 billion dollars over the next four years, a move that has angered the community and led to a grassroots movement that aims to shake up the energy landscape. "Power San Diego," a community-led initiative, is challenging the status quo, proposing a bold plan to replace San Diego Gas & Electric (SDG&E) with a not-for-profit public power utility. This ambitious move, spearheaded by determined San Diegans, is not just about altering power management—it's about reshaping the city's energy future. The Spark of Discontent San Diego, like many cities, has been grappling with soaring electricity rates, leaving residents searching for alternatives. The rising costs have stirred significant concern among residents already burdened by high costs of living. In response, Power San Diego emerged from this collective frustration, fueled by the desire for fairer prices and a sustainable energy approach. This initiative isn't just a protest against high rates; it's a vision for a different kind of energy future. The Vision of Public Power At the heart of Power San Diego's mission is the transition to a public power utility. This shift promises several advantages: Reduced Energy Rates: By moving away from the profit-driven model of SDG&E, a public utility aims to offer more affordable energy to residents. Protection of Rooftop Solar Installations: In an era where sustainable practices are crucial, safeguarding solar installations is key to encouraging renewable energy adoption. Local Energy Generation and Storage: Focusing on local solutions means more efficient, responsive, and tailored energy services for San Diegans.   Bill Powers, the campaign's chair, encapsulates the sentiment driving this initiative: “The only way for us to be able to craft our own destiny as a city in both controlling our electric rates and coming up with the most cost-effective, smartest, innovative decarbonization clean energy plan is to have local control of the electric power utility. Without that local control, we do not control our destiny.”   The Road to a Ballot Measure The journey for "Power San Diego" is undoubtedly an uphill one, fraught with bureaucratic and logistical hurdles. Yet, the resolve of its members and the support of the community signal a new era of energy management in San Diego, one where the power belongs to the people.   The path to change is paved with challenges, and "Power San Diego" is gearing up for a significant one. The group is embarking on a mission to collect over 80,000 signatures to get their measure on the 2024 ballot. If successful, this would be the first step in what could mark a turning point in how San Diego manages energy.   The Potential Impact The implications of this initiative are far-reaching. Credit Agreement Default SunPower, a rooftop solar company majority-owned by TotalEnergies SE, faced a significant setback with a 41% drop in its stock. The root cause lies in a subsidiary's default under its credit agreement, attributed to delays in delivering third-quarter financial statements. 2. Liquidity Concerns The company raised alarms about potential liquidity issues. If lenders demand immediate repayment, SunPower might struggle to meet its obligations and pay liabilities, leading to doubts about its ability to continue as a "going concern." 3. Ownership and Financial Support Despite these challenges, SunPower, backed by its majority owner TotalEnergies SE, is actively engaging in discussions with lenders and equity sponsors. Additionally, the company secured $50 million from its revolving credit facility, aiming to strengthen its long-term financial position. 4. Potential Liabilities and Cash Flow Challenges Analysts estimate potential liabilities exceeding $65 million for SunPower. Cash flow challenges pose concerns for dealers associated with the solar company, potentially leading to constraints. 5. Industry Headwinds SunPower's struggle is not isolated; it reflects broader challenges in the solar industry. The sector, particularly home solar companies, has been hit by a sales slowdown. Rising interest rates have made borrowing for solar installations more expensive, contributing to the industry's woes. 6. Clean-Energy Stocks in Turmoil SunPower's stock decline is part of a larger trend affecting clean-energy stocks. Central bank tightening has exacerbated challenges in the sector, with SunPower's shares plummeting over 75% this year. Federal ITC The biggest solar incentive that every solar panel owner is eligible for is the federal investment tax credit (ITC). This incentive gives homeowners 30% of the cost of their solar panels back in the form of a tax credit. So, if your solar panels are $20,000, you can claim $6,000 on your federal taxes. These claims are exclusively for solar panels installed between 2022 and 2032. In 2033, the ITC will go down to 26%, then 22% by 2034, so the time is now to have your panels installed. California Solar Incentives for 2024 On top of the federal ITC, there are incentives exclusively for certain Californians who decide to go solar. In particular, these incentives target low-income households, offering them a way to get free solar installation. This program is called the DAC-SASH rebate program. It's implemented by the California Public Utilities Commission and has very specific qualifications that you can read about. There are a few different one-time rebate programs, such as the Self-Generation Incentive Program and Equity Resilience Incentives. Most Californians will also be eligible for the Solar Energy Property Tax Exclusion. This halts any increase to your property taxes after you install solar panels. Tesla Powerwall Lifespan To begin, let's look at some of the factors that will affect your battery's lifespan. Generally speaking, your Tesla storage battery should last about 8-10 years. However, the true range varies much greater. Here are the primary factors in your Tesla Powerwall's lifespan. Type and Size One of the first things to look at is the type and size of Tesla Powerwall you have. As a rule of thumb, smaller-capacity batteries won't last as long. This is primarily because a smaller battery is expended and recharged significantly more often than a larger one. The process of your Tesla charging and discharging will add wear and tear, thus reducing its lifespan. Location Another factor in your Tesla Powerwall lifespan measurement is the battery's location. High temperatures and humidity will make your battery die out sooner. A battery in the Floridian heat won't last as long as one in a cooler climate, such as Washington. Heavy Use Finally, the amount of power you're drawing from your Powerwall will affect its cycle. Your Tesla discharging deeply will cause strain for some of the cells within the battery.  You can reduce this by avoiding deep discharges. A deep discharge is a use case where you use half or more of the battery's capacity. When to Replace Now that we know more about how long your battery will last, how do you know when to replace the battery? Knowing when to replace your solar battery backup is refreshingly simple. All you need to do is look out for some telltale signs. For example, if your battery is struggling to hold a charge, it's likely failing. You may also experience frequent power outages, which shows that your battery isn't providing enough power. Another easy way to tell is if there's physical damage to your Tesla storage battery. Corrosion on the outer case means that it's approaching the end of its lifespan or is malfunctioning. Pay attention to your battery and power usage. The only question is, "Which battery suits you best?". Keep reading to find out if the Tesla Powerwall is a good fit for your home. What Is a Tesla Powerwall? The Tesla Powerwall is a wall-mounted battery that stores electricity from the grid or solar panels for later use. It automatically detects power outages and can keep your lights on and your appliances running for hours without electricity. When combined with solar panels, the Tesla Powerwall can keep your appliances running for days on end without using any electricity from the grid. The Powerwall produces no noise or emissions and requires little upkeep. How Much Does a Powerwall Cost? All solar battery solutions are expensive, and you can expect to pay between $9,200 and $18,000 for a Tesla Powerwall, depending on the installation costs. You can save by taking advantage of the federal solar tax credit when you buy solar batteries. This means you can deduct 30% of what you paid for your battery from your income tax in the same year. Some states and utilities offer additional incentives when you install solar batteries. In California, you can save up to 90% on the cost of your Powerwall thanks to these incentives. What Does the Tesla Powerwall Offer? Some things to consider when you're considering the best Powerwall battery for your home include energy capacity, power ratings, round-trip efficiency, and depth of discharge. The Tesla Powerwall won't disappoint in any of these areas. Energy Capacity Tesla Powerwall capacity is 13.5 kWh, which is enough to output 3250 watts for four hours. The fewer watts you use from your Powerwall, the longer it will keep running. Most appliances have a sticker attached to them that indicates the wattage they use, so you can easily manipulate your energy consumption. Continuous Power Rating Continuous power rating refers to how much electricity a battery can provide continuously while connected to a grid or solar system. The Tesla Powerwall continuous power ratings vary from 5.8 kW for an on-grid installation with no sun to 9.6 kW for an off-grid installation with full sun. You may need up to 14 solar panels to charge your Tesla Powerwall, depending on the solar hours available in your area. Round Trip Efficiency and Depth of Discharge Round trip efficiency refers to how efficiently a battery converts incoming energy into usable electricity. The Powerwall has a 90% efficiency rating and a 100% depth of discharge. This means all the energy stored in the battery is available for use. This article explains what those are, so you can make the best choice based on your unique energy needs.  Daily Energy Consumption One of the biggest factors in determining the needed solar battery backup size is daily energy consumption. You should be able to find this information on your existing energy bill. It is most often reported in kilowatt-hours (kWh). Divide this number by 30 (approximate days in a month) and multiply it by 1,000. This will give you how many watts of power are sustained over one hour. Solar System Generating Capacity Next, you need to consider how much energy your solar panel system (if you already have one) will generate in a day. This is based on the size and type of solar panels you have, as well as the number of sunny days where you live. Subtract your daily energy consumption from the average amount of power generation your system puts out on any given day. El Cajon averages about 260 sunny days per year, far above the national average. This means there are less than 100 days every year when your full solar generating capacity may not be reached. Days of Backup The size battery you need is also affected by how many days of backup you desire. If you only plan to rely on backup batteries overnight, then a smaller battery will be sufficient. For longer stretches, such as several cloudy days, then a larger battery will be warranted. Battery Type Finally, there are many different types of solar battery backup El Cajon has to offer. Flooded and sealed lead acid batteries are inexpensive, but they require a lot of maintenance and ventilation. They also only last between three and seven years. Lithium-ion are some of the best batteries for solar power storage. They will last 10 years or more, with no maintenance or venting required. They also charge faster, are more efficient, and have greater usable capacity, or "discharge depth."
